WebThe national attitude to financial literacy, planning and difficulty Findings in 2024. The Money Advice Service surveyed nearly 6,000 adults living in the UK for the 2024 Adult Financial Capability Survey. From the answers to more than 100 questions, we identified the key components of financial capability and the relationships between them. Web26 nov. 2024 · This release compiles information on education systems across the United Kingdom. Education is devolved in the UK, so each part of the United Kingdom has a separate education system, with different attainment measures. The relationships described in this document are not exclusively found in the British context. Rather, they have been replicated in various countries, most notably in the United States, Canada and Australia. Males aged 15 and over have a literacy rate of 90%, while females lag only slightly behind at 82.7%. However, massive country-to-country differences exist. Developed nations almost always have an adult literacy rate of 96% or better. devils tower visitor center hoursWeb19 mei 2024 · The UK faces major challenges from the COVID-19 crisis and leaving the EU Single Market.
